Memories from early life are over-represented in a lifetime distribution, a phenomenon referred to as the reminiscence bump.

The memory bump is the expanded percentage of autobiographical reminiscences from teens and early adulthood observed in adults over 40. it is one of the maximum robust findings in autobiographical reminiscence studies.

The memory bump is caused by age-related differences in encoding performance, which motive more memories to be stored in youth and early maturity.

The reminiscence impact, wherein humans aged 40 and over consider extra autobiographical memories from between ages 10 to 30 than from adjoining periods, generating a “bump” in lifespan distributions, is a distinctly sturdy effect.

Emerging adulthood is when most people move toward making definite, long-term choices in ____
zvonat [6]

Emerging adulthood is when most people move toward making definite, long-term choices in love and work.

The age of identity exploration is a characteristic of emerging adulthood. As individuals progress toward making lasting decisions, people consider many options in both love and work. By experimenting with many options, individuals establish a more clear sense of who they are, what their views and values are, and how they fit into the culture in which they live. Emerging adulthood is also a self-focused age. Erik Erikson developed the concept of identity and suggested that it primarily concerns people when they enter adulthood. Explorations of developing adulthood also make it the age of instability and various possibilities in both love and work.
